Treasury says most stimulus payments to the dead recouped

By Angelica | Sep 1, 2020 | Comments Off on Treasury says most stimulus payments to the dead recouped

The Trump administration said it’s recovered almost 70 percent of $1.6 billion in relief payments mistakenly sent to dead people as the government rushed out stimulus money to blunt the economic impact of the coronavirus, according to a government watchdog. Lockton Capital Markets names ex-Lehman Re exec Ghosh as President

By Angelica | Sep 1, 2020 | Comments Off on Lockton Capital Markets names ex-Lehman Re exec Ghosh as President

Lockton Capital Markets, the unit with an alternative reinsurance capital and insurance-linked securities (ILS) focus at the largest independent insurance broker of the same name, has announced the appointment of Pradip Ghosh as President, effective immediately.
